还没有找到合适的课程?赶快告诉课程顾问,让我们顾问马上联系您! 靠谱的培训课程,省时又省力!
通过对“十四五”规划和2035年远景目标《建议》: 向第二个百年奋斗目标进军的行动指南的解读,未来是我国从数量建设过度到质量建设的重要时期。软件测试作为软件质量保障的重要手段,在软件质量时代来临之际变得日趋重要,对于软件测试人才的需求也将日益上涨。打造学员自身核心竞争力,成为软件测试学科提质培优的重中之重。
课程优势
企业课程 | 当地就业 | 深耕Python栈 | 多元测试 |
对标大厂人员招聘刚需,打造自动化测试工程师。 | 针对当地企业招聘需求,专研课程内容。 | 以专攻Python技术栈为主的软件测试授课内容。 | 理论+实战+工具,构建学员体系化测试思维。 |
结合当地企业需求研发课程,家门口学习即就业
稳步提升 | 升级优势 | 热门技 |
专攻企业课程内容 - 专攻Python栈,让学员更轻松掌握流行的自动化测试技术 - 专攻市场使用最广泛的关系型数据库,其他类型数据库技术课程免费赠送,面向大数据专项测试更加游刃有余 - 专攻市场使用最广泛的关系型数据库,其他类型数据库技术课程免费赠送,面向大数据专项测试更加游刃有余 - python栈技术全打通(每个语言都能实现web自动化、接口自动化、移动端自动化等) | 强化开发、接口测试,更具实战性 - 实现真正意义上的测试环境全栈覆盖,包含LAMP、dock、云服务等 - 全面升级为python技术课程,紧贴企业对软件测试高端用人需求 - 实现了当前行业对全栈软件测试工程师应同时具备前后端开发技术的硬性技能要求 - 全面覆盖UI自动化、API自动化、单元自动化、App自动化等多个自动化测试技术应用领域 - 符合深圳速度的课程周期,让学员更快更好的找到理想工作 | 大厂热门技术 - 覆盖Python+Selenium+Unittest:互联网流行Web自动化测试框架 - 覆盖Python+Requests+Pytest:大厂流行接口自动化测试框架 - 覆盖python+Appium+Jenkins:互联网公司高效移动端自动化测试框架 - 覆盖Jmeter+ant+Jenkins:行业流行接口测试持续集成 - 覆盖UFT、Loadrunner工具的商用工具加持,Loadrunner、Jmeter性能测试工具 |
课程大纲
第一阶段 软件测试环境配置和管理 | 第二阶段算 web前端测试技术 | 第三阶段 软件测试数据管理与数据库测试 | 第四阶段 通用软件测试技术 |
虚拟机基础和操作系统安装 1.虚拟机概述 2.虚拟机作用 3.虚拟机环境配置与安装 | HTML的基本标签和表单操作 1.html基本知识概述 2.html基本框架 3.HTML基本标签使用:标题标签,段落标签等 4.超链接标签应用 5.音频视频标签应用 6.图片标签以及属性的应用 7.常见的表单输入项元素的使用 8.表单单选,多选,下列列表,文本域等标签使用 9.重置,提交等功能的实现 | MySQL数据库介绍 1.数据库技术所研究的问题 2.SQL语言概述 3.DB,DBS,DBMS之间关系 4.关系模型 5.关系的完整性约束 6.三范式 7.实体联系模型 8. E-R图 | 软件测试的由来和缺陷报告 1.软件测试的来源 2.软件测试的定义:正向、反向 3.软件测试的目的 4.测试与调试的区别 5.软件缺陷的来源 6.软件缺陷的定义 7.缺陷的属性:严重等级,优先级等 8.缺陷的生命周期 9.缺陷报告编写目的和预期读者 10.缺陷报告的编写和描述准则 |
Linux系统环境搭建 1.Linux概述与特征 2.Linux操作系统环境搭建 3.Linux操作系统环境配置 | MySQL数据库的安装与配置 1.MySQL数据库的发展史 2.MySQL数据库的特征 3.MySQL数据库的安装 4.MySQL数据库的配置与连接操作 | 用例和用例设计方法一-等价类、边界值 1.测试用例概述 2.测试用例编写注意事项 3.黑盒测试用例设计方法概述 4.黑盒测试用例设计方法-等价类划分法 5.黑盒测试用例设计方法-边界值分析法 | |
Linux系统操作命令 1.Linux常见的目录结构概述 2.目录文件操作命令:grep,vi/vim,rm,find等 3.线上查询命令:man,locate,whatis等 4.文件备份与压缩命令:bzip2,gzip,tar等 5.文件阅读命令:head,tail,more等 6.定位,查找文件命令:which,whereis等 7.管理使用者和设置权限的命令:chmod,chgrp,chown,su等 8.有关关机和查看系统信息的命令:ps,top,kill等 9.磁盘空间操作命令:df,du等 10.网络操作命令:ifconfig,ping,netstat等 11.其它命令:echo,wc,uptime等 | CSS层叠样式表基础 1.CSS样式表概述 2.CSS样式表的作用 3.内部样式表的使用 4.内嵌(行内)样式表的应用 5.外部样式表的使用 6.CSS样式表中常见的属性 | MySQL图形化客户端操作 1.Navicat配置与使用 2.Navicat连接MySQL数据库 3.Navicat实现对MySQL数据库的创建 4.Navicat实现对MySQL数据库的删除 | 测试流程和用例设计方法二-因果图、判定表、场景法 1.黑盒测试用例设计方法-因果图法 2.黑盒测试用例设计方法-判定表法 3.黑盒测试用例设计方法-场景法 |
Linux软件包管理 1.软件包管理操作 2.rpm命令操作 3.yum命令操作 | H5新标签和新属性 1.H5新标签元素的使用 2.H5新标签元素属性应用 | Mysql数据库中表的操作以及约束关联 1.MySQL中常见的数据类型 2.MySQL中表的创建操作 3.MySQL中表结构的修改操作 4.MySQL中表的删除操作 5.MySQL表中约束的操作:主键约束,外键约束,唯一约束,默认约束,非空约束 | 用例设计方法三-正交实验和其他 1.黑盒测试用例设计方法-正交实验法,正交设计助手应用 2.黑盒测试用例设计方法-错误推测法 3.探索性测试 4.测试大纲法 5.Monkey测试 6.用例设计方法综合选择 |
Linux内核与网络配置 1.Linux内核参数概述 2.Linux内核修改操作 3.Linux动态网络配置 4.Linux静态网络配置 | CSS样式选择器 1.CSS类样式选择器 2.CSSid样式选择器 3.CSS派生选择器 | MySQL数据库的增删改操作 1.MySQL对表中的数据的insert插入操作 2.MySQL对表中的数据的update修改操作 3.MySQL对表中的数据的delete删除操作 | 软件工程、开发模型、软件质量模型 1.软件工程方法学 2.软件的生命周期 3.软件开发过程模型-瀑布模型,增量模型,敏捷模型等 |
Shell编程基础 1.shell概述与作用 2.shell环境构成 3.shell变量的操作 4.shell运算符操作-算数,比较,逻辑,字符串,文件测试运算符等 5.shell语句结构-if,case,for,while语句等操作 6.shell输入输出重定向和文件包含操作 | MySQL数据库的单表和多表的相关查询操作 1.MySQL对表的基本查询操作 2.MySQL条件查询 3.MySQL去重复查询和行数限定查询 4.MySQL聚合函数和别名查询 5.MySQL分组和排序查询 6.MySQL多表连接查询 7.MySQL外查询操作 8.MySQL子查询操作 | 测试模型和测试方法和软件质量保证 1.软件测试流程 2.软件测试过程模型-V模型,W模型,H模型等 3.软件测试过程理念 | |
LAMP环境原理和搭建 1.LAMP环境概述以及作用 2.LAMP环境组成架构 3.LAMP环境的安装与配置 4.LAMP环境中电商项目部署 | JS基础 1.JS基本语法结构 2.JS流程控制语句-判断条件语句,循环语句 3.JS函数的应用 4.JS事件与事件处理 5.JS正则表达式 | MySQL视图操作 1.MySQL视图概述 2.MySQL视图作用 3.MySQL视图的创建,修改,删除操作 4.MySQL视图中数据的增删改查操作 5.MySQL视图与实表的关联 | 需求和测试需求分析 1.测试需求 2.需求定义 3.需求分类:显示需求,隐式需求 4.需求跟踪 5.需求评审:定义,分类,流程 |
Docker容器技术基础 1.Docker概述 2.Docker作用 3.Docker与虚拟机的异同点 | MySQL索引操作 1.MySQL索引概述 2.MySQL索引的作用 3.MySQL索引的优缺点 4.MySQL索引的创建与删除操作 | 测试计划制定和编写 1.测试计划概述 2.测试计划作用 3.测试计划内容 4.测试计划案例分析 | |
Docker原理与基本操作 1.Docker原理 2.Docker的应用场景 3.Docker的安装 4.Docker镜像管理 5.Docker的基本操作命令使用 6.Docker容器管理操作 | DOM基础 1.DOM作用 2.DOM 对象的方法操作 3.DOM对象的属性 3.DOM修改操作 | MySQL权限管理 1.MySQL权限介绍以及权限级别 2.用户权限的查看,修改操作 3.用户权限信息管理与系统权限 | 评审和风险分析 1.评审概述 2.评审的准备和流程 3.评审的误区 4.评审的过程和结果跟踪 5.软件风险 6.风险分析过程 7.应对风险的举措 |
Docker环境部署配置 1.阿里云服务器的配置与使用 2.云服务器端Docker安装与配置 3.Docker平台部署LAMP环境操作 4.LAMP中测试项目环境部署 | MySQL数据库的存储过程和触发器 1.MySQL存储过程的作用 2.MySQL存储过程的创建操作 3.MySQL存储过程的调用与执行 4.触发器作用 5.触发器的创建,修改与删除 | 测试总结和报告 1.测试总结报告包含内容 2.测试总结报告案例分析 |
软件测试培训机构推荐十家名单:(排名不分先后) 1、达内教育 2、汇智动力 3、火星时代 4、完美动力 5、博为峰 6、天琥教育 7、CGWANG教育 8、上海交大南洋学院 9、上元教育 10、火星人教育 软件测试的培训机构并没有什么排名名单,全部都是网上随便编排的排名,并没有什么作用。 |
W模型的缺点
1、W模型也存在局限性。在W模型中,需求、设计、编码等活动被视为串行的,同时,测试和开发活动也保持着一种线性的前后关系,上一阶段完全结束,才可正式开始下一个阶段工作。这样就无法支持迭代的开发模型。2、对于当前软件开发复杂多变的情况,W模型并不能解除测试管理面临着困惑。
确认测试的目的
确认测试的目的是向未来的用户表明系统能够像预定要求那样工作。经集成测试后,已经按照设计把所有的模块组装成一个完整的软件系统,接口错误也已经基本排除了,接着就应该进一步验证软件的有效性,这就是确认测试的任务,即软件的功能和性能如同用户所合理期待的那样。
穷尽测试是不可能的
测试所有的输入和条件组合是不可能的,除非是极其简单的情况。可以取而代之的是基 于风险和优先级的测试。 当不懂装懂的老板要求你彻底测试一个软件的时候,这是你反驳的最好支持,当然要说的委婉一点。
领域知识
了解不同的领域对于每个 QA 或 软件测试人员来说都是必不可少的。测试人员可以利用软件测试领域的知识变得更有创造力。因此,它有助于提高软件产品的价值。拥有良好的领域知识将以改进的方式帮助每个测试人员清楚地了解客户需要或满足客户要求的测试技术。
软件配置管理工具
配置管理工具是指支持完成配置项标识、版本控制、变化控制、审计和状态统计等任务的工具。目标]实现配置支持,版本控制,变更控制,构造支持,过程支持,团队支持,报告/查询,审计控制和其他功能。
如何使用查询缓冲区
查询缓冲区可以提高查询的速度,但是这种方式只适合查询语句比较多、更新语句比较少 的情况。默认情况下查询缓冲区的大小为〇,也就是不可用。可以修改queiy_cache_size以调整 查询缓冲区大小;修改query_cache_type以调整查询缓冲区的类型。在my.ini中修改 query_cache_size 和 query_cache_type 的值如下所示:表示开启查询缓冲区。只有在查询语句中包含SQL_NO_CACHE关键字 时,才不会使用查询缓冲区。可以使用FLUSH QUERY CACHE语句来刷新缓冲区,清理查询缓 冲区中的碎片。
扫描二维码免费领取试听课程
登录51乐学网
注册51乐学网